Catherine "Kay" (Anania) Saba, 81, of Brockton, passed away Wednesday, January 16, 2013 at the Massachusetts General Hospital in Boston. She was the wife of the late Philip M. Saba (Retired Principal of Randolph High School)
Born April 19, 1931 in Brockton, she was the daughter of the late Gaetano Anania and Elizabeth (Dodero) Anania. A lifelong Brockton resident, she graduated from Brockton High School in 1949. She then graduated from Boston University in 1953 where she was a member of the Phi Beta Kappa and Phi Omega Phil.
Kay was a School Teacher at Randolph High School and for the Brockton School System for 35 years. She retired in 1994.
She was a communicant of St. Theresa Maronite Catholic Church in Brockton.
She is survived by her children, Joanne Nash and her husband Johnny of South Carolina and Philip M. Saba, II of Brockton; her grandchildren, Philip M. Saba, III and Matthew Saba; she is also survived by several nieces and nephews. She was the sister of the late Marion Barry and Joanne Alfonso.
